Dr. G. Muthukumaran is a pioneering robotics researcher whose work bridges the critical gap between theoretical modeling and practical deployment in challenging environments. His primary research areas include wall-climbing robotics, pneumatic actuation systems, and nanorobotics for medical applications. Dr. Muthukumaran’s most significant contribution is the development of an active suction chamber-based wall climbing robot featuring a novel bottom restrictor, which dramatically improves suction pressure generation and stability on vertical surfaces. This innovation, detailed in his most-cited paper (19 citations), enables reliable maneuvering on diverse wall surfaces—a crucial capability for hazardous inspection and maintenance operations. He further advanced the field by modeling and realizing a pneumatics-based wall climbing robot specifically designed for high-rise building inspection, addressing the fundamental challenge of vertical locomotion against gravity. Beyond macro-scale robotics, Dr. Muthukumaran has explored the frontier of nanorobotics, investigating the design and medical applications of sub-micrometer-scale devices for targeted therapeutic interventions.
